Matthew Shakespeare recently attended the Sustainable Forestry Initiative (SFI) annual conference. Here's what he had to say about his experience: "From October 22-24, I had the privilege of being one of two lucky Canadian students that received a scholarship to attend the SFI annual conference in Richmond, Virginia. The SFI hosted several amazing speakers, including a manager from Project Learnjng Tree promoting Green Jobs across Canada on a wooden bike and speakers discuss...ing the role of SFI certifications from a religious perspective and through the experience of African-American land owners. The experience was amazing and our hosts went to great lengths to engage student attendees. There were volunteer mentors to offer advice and facilitate introductions, as well as an interactive career building workshop. SFI wants to actively engage with forestry students, and they are hoping to double the number of students and mentors for the 2020 conference in Vancouver. For more information on SFI's Conference Scholarship or the conference itself, please reach out to Rocco Saracina, Manager of Conservation Partnerships at [email protected]." See more
